Master the Cloud: Creative Ways to Learn Cloud Computing
- jobs1057
- Jul 31
- 4 min read

Cloud computing has transformed the digital world, making it easier for individuals and businesses to access, manage, and store data without relying on physical infrastructure. Whether you're an aspiring developer, IT enthusiast, or business professional, exploring ideas for learning cloud computing can open new career paths and broaden your technical expertise. With the rise of services like AWS, Microsoft Azure, and Google Cloud, cloud computing skills are now in high demand across the globe.
Why Learn Cloud Computing?
Cloud computing is no longer a trend—it’s a fundamental skill in today’s tech-driven economy. From hosting websites to deploying machine learning models and running complex enterprise systems, cloud platforms serve as the backbone for innovation. According to Gartner, public cloud services are expected to grow by over 20% annually, reaching nearly $600 billion by 2025. This exponential growth makes cloud literacy a vital asset.
Understand the Basics First
Before diving into advanced tools, it’s important to build a strong foundation. Start by understanding:
What is Cloud Computing?
Deployment Models: Explore on-demand computing, scalability, and virtualization.
Free online platforms like AWS Skill Builder and Microsoft Learn provide beginner-friendly content that introduces cloud fundamentals in a structured way.
Choose a Cloud Platform to Specialize In While learning the theory is important, hands-on experience with a specific cloud platform brings real value. The three most popular providers are:
Microsoft Azure: Widely used in enterprises, integrates well with Windows and Office tools.
Google Cloud Platform (GCP): Known for its data and AI/ML capabilities.
Pick one platform to start with and explore its console, services, and documentation. AWS offers a free tier that lets beginners deploy virtual machines, host databases, and test various services at no cost.
Top Ideas for Learning Cloud Effectively
Let’s explore some actionable ideas for learning cloud computing that will help you gain practical knowledge and boost your confidence:
1. Follow a Structured Certification Path
Cloud certifications help validate your skills and are recognized by employers worldwide. Start with foundational certificates like:
AWS Certified Cloud Practitioner
Microsoft Certified: Azure Fundamentals
Google Cloud Digital Leader
Once you're comfortable, progress to associate-level certifications in architecture, development, or security. These courses include real-world case studies and hands-on labs.
2. Build Real Projects
Nothing beats learning by doing. Try building small projects that simulate real business problems:
Deploy a portfolio website using Amazon S3
Create a serverless application using AWS Lambda
Host a WordPress blog on Google Cloud
Use Azure to create a chatbot using their Cognitive Services
Projects help reinforce theoretical knowledge and showcase your skills to potential employers.
3. Join Online Communities and Forums
Engaging with cloud computing communities on Reddit, Stack Overflow, LinkedIn, and Discord can accelerate your learning. You can ask questions, share your progress, and collaborate on group challenges.
4. Participate in Cloud Hackathons and Bootcamps
Many cloud providers host free or low-cost bootcamps and virtual hackathons. These short, intense programs allow you to learn cloud skills under expert guidance and compete for prizes.
5. Watch YouTube Tutorials and Attend Webinars
YouTube has thousands of cloud tutorials for every skill level. Channels like freeCodeCamp, TechWorld with Nana, and AWS provide step-by-step videos. Also, attend live webinars from Microsoft, Google, and Amazon to learn about the latest updates and best practices.
6. Use Cloud Labs and Simulators
If you want to avoid the cost of setting up cloud infrastructure, use lab-based environments like:
Qwiklabs (by Google Cloud)
AWS Cloud Quest
Microsoft Learn Sandbox
These labs provide guided environments for free or at low cost, helping you practice without risking real infrastructure.
7. Learn About Cloud Security and Compliance
Security is a core part of cloud computing. Learn how identity and access management (IAM), data encryption, firewalls, and secure storage work in a cloud environment. You’ll gain knowledge that’s applicable across all industries, from healthcare to finance.
8. Stay Updated with Blogs and Podcasts
Stay current by following cloud-centric blogs like Cloud Academy, A Cloud Guru, and AWS News Blog.
AWS Podcast
Google Cloud Platform Podcast
Cloud Security Podcast by Google
These resources keep you informed about industry trends, product updates, and best practices.
Mid-Learning Evaluation
Once you've spent a few weeks learning and experimenting, assess your progress by:
Taking practice exams
Explaining key concepts to a friend
Writing blogs or LinkedIn posts about your learning journey
This reflection will identify gaps and reinforce your understanding.
Career Opportunities with Cloud Skills
Learning cloud computing opens the door to multiple career roles such as:
Cloud Engineer
Cloud Solutions Architect
DevOps Engineer
Cloud Security Analyst
Site Reliability Engineer (SRE)
According to Glassdoor, the average salary for cloud professionals in India ranges from ₹6 to ₹30 LPA, depending on experience and certification.
Final Thoughts
In conclusion, exploring various ideas for learning cloud computing can help you gain in-demand skills, build real-world projects, and earn industry-recognized certifications. Whether you're a student, freelancer, or IT professional, cloud knowledge enhances your profile and gives you a competitive edge in the job market. Your journey to becoming cloud-proficient begins to
Comments